What does enterprise computing mean?
Career: Enterprise Computing
Enterprise computing refers to the use of large-scale information technology systems and infrastructure to support the operations of organizations. It involves managing servers, networks, databases, and applications to ensure efficient business processes, often requiring skills in system administration, cybersecurity, and cloud platforms.
